About this wine

Muraje is a small, highly regarded producer working old terraces in the Carema DOC at the foothills of the Alps. Patlù is their core Carema bottling, from steep, pergola-trained Nebbiolo. The 2020 vintage yields a pale ruby wine with aromas of wild strawberry, cranberry, alpine herbs, rose and crushed stone, plus a touch of spice. The palate is taut and vertical rather than rich, with high acidity, fine but insistent tannins and a saline, almost smoky mineral finish – think a mountain cousin of traditional Barolo, but lighter.

Muraje

Muraje is a tiny, highly artisanal project in Carema, working steep, terraced vineyards at the northern edge of Piedmont. The focus is on pure, high-altitude Nebbiolo that’s pale, aromatic and wonderfully tense, more about perfume and minerality than weight. Low intervention in the cellar lets the mountain character shine through.
